"Mr President, I would like to thank the rapporteur for a very well-written report – much better written than a lot of what we vote on in this Chamber. I also agree that the text concerning GMOs and zero tolerance in this report is very unfortunate. It runs completely counter to the report as a whole, but is, of course, also very unfortunate in itself. I would also like to emphasise the positive effects on the climate that growing more protein crops in the EU would entail. There are grounds for doing this. However, there is also a very major issue that is not resolved anywhere in this report, namely, the fact that we are eating more and more meat. The more money we have, the more meat we eat, the greater the impact on the climate and the more protein crops are needed. What are we doing about this major issue, which is the crux of this whole debate? That is a question for the future, both for us and for the European Commission."@en1
